A gas turbine is an internal combustion engine that generates power through the expansion of hot gases. It comprises a compressor, combustion chamber, and turbine, where compressed air and fuel are ignited to produce high-pressure gas that spins the turbine. Gas turbines are widely utilized in power plants, aircraft, and various industrial applications.
